The Evolution: From Manual to PDR for Auto Body Shops

dent removal process

The evolution of auto body shop practices has seen a significant shift from traditional dent repair methods to the adoption of Paintless Dent Repair (PDR). This change reflects a broader industry trend towards more efficient and specialized automotive collision repair techniques. PDR vs traditional dent repair offers distinct advantages, particularly in the context of luxury vehicle repair, where precision and minimal disruption to the original finish are paramount.

Historically, auto body shops relied on manual techniques for removing dents, often involving sandblasting, painting, and extensive panel replacement. These methods were time-consuming, labor-intensive, and could result in visible scars on the vehicle’s surface. In contrast, PDR employs specialized tools and techniques to repair dents without affecting the paint job. This non-invasive approach allows for faster turnaround times and significantly reduces costs, making it a preferred choice for modern auto body shops catering to diverse customer needs.

The benefits of PDR are particularly evident in the luxury automotive sector, where customers expect high-quality finishes and meticulous craftsmanship. By eliminating the need for extensive repainting and panel replacement, PDR preserves the vehicle’s original value and aesthetic appeal. Moreover, it streamlines the repair process, enabling auto body shops to service a wider range of vehicles, including those with intricate paint designs and precious materials. As the demand for efficient, cost-effective, and high-quality automotive repair continues to grow, the shift towards PDR is poised to accelerate, reshaping the landscape of auto body shops globally.

Cost-Effectiveness: Comparing PDR vs Traditional Dent Repair Methods

dent removal process

The shift towards more cost-effective dent removal techniques has significantly reshaped auto body repair industries globally. When compared to traditional dent repair methods, PDR (Paintless Dent Repair) offers a compelling alternative for both auto body shops and their customers. The primary advantage lies in the reduction of labor costs associated with conventional repairs, which often involve extensive painting and panel replacement. A study by the International Automotive Body Repairs Association (IABR) revealed that PDR can save up to 50% on average per repair compared to traditional methods, making it an attractive option for auto repair shops aiming to enhance profitability while providing quality service.

PDR’s efficiency translates directly into time and cost savings. The method allows technicians to perform dent removal without disassembling or replacing damaged panels, significantly reducing the complexity of the repair process. This minimalism not only lowers labor costs but also streamlines the overall workflow, enabling auto body shops to accommodate a higher volume of repairs within the same timeframe. For instance, a typical fender bender that would have required several hours and multiple technicians using traditional methods can often be fixed in under an hour by a single PDR specialist. This increased productivity means faster turnaround times for customers and reduced waiting periods, enhancing customer satisfaction.

Furthermore, PDR’s focus on preserving the original factory finish of vehicles offers distinct advantages over traditional dent repair. By avoiding painting and repainting, auto body shops can mitigate potential issues like color mismatch or surface imperfections that may arise from conventional methods. This not only ensures a higher quality aesthetic but also reduces the risk of future repairs being necessary due to substandard work. As consumer expectations for flawless finishes continue to rise, PDR has emerged as a game-changer in the auto body repair landscape, compelling many shops to adopt these techniques to stay competitive and meet modern standards.
